    Bodmin Foyer

    Who do we help? Young single homeless people aged 16-25. Priority is given to those with local connection. Who we cannot help Applications considered on a case by case basis. Gender Mixed Minimum age accepted 16 Maximum age accepted 25 How to get a referral…

    Cornwall Leaving Care Team - Open Door Supported Lodgings

    Open Door provides supported lodgings for Cornwall Care leavers aged 16 to 17 as part of their move on from Foster and Residential care to independence. Supported lodging provision for 16 and 17-year-old Cornwall Care Leavers. Providers are vetted and assessed and provide some support…

    Truro Foyer

    Truro Foyer has 12 bedspaces for 16-25 year olds. It is located right in the city centre. It has 6 flats each shared by two young people. There is a separate meeting room available for hire and a separate training kitchen for young people to…
